#d593c0 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#d593c0 is composed of 83.5% red, 57.6% green and 75.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 31% magenta, 9.9% yellow and 16.5% black. It has a hue angle of 319.1 degrees, a saturation of 44% and a lightness of 70.6%. #d593c0 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#ab2781. Closest websafe color is: #cc99cc.

Shades and Tints of #d593c0
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050204 is the darkest color, while #fbf6fa is the lightest one.

Tones of #d593c0
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#b8b0b6 is the less saturated color, while #fd6bcf is the most saturated one.
